Number Of Burlington County Coronavirus Cases Now 15: Officials
Burlington County officials provided details on the four new cases of new coronavirus cases reported by state officials on Thursday.
BURLINGTON COUNTY, NJ — Burlington County officials provided details on the four new cases of new coronavirus cases reported by state officials on Thursday. Contact tracing is underway in the cases of:
- A 63-year-old Bordentown woman;
- A 20-year-old Mount Laurel woman;
- A 45-year-old Tabernacle woman; and
- An 85-year-old Mount Laurel woman.
The number of positive coronavirus cases countywide has reached 15. State officials said there were six new cases in Camden County, and 318 new cases statewide. There have now been 742 total cases of coronavirus reported statewide, including nine deaths. Read more here: Gov. Phil Murphy: 4 More NJ Coronavirus Deaths, 318 New Cases

State officials were set to meet later Thursday with representatives from Inspira about re-opening a hospital in Woodbury. The current professional occupants of the offices must be moved out, and mental health services must be relocated, New Jersey Health Officer Judith Persichelli said during a press conference Thursday afternoon.
Other upgrades must be done to the building, which officials are hoping to reopen as a hospital in about 3-4 weeks. See related: Camden Area Hospitals Lack Beds For Coronavirus Surge: Report

The New Jersey Department of Health has partnered with the New Jersey Poison Information and Education System to open and operate a call center (1-800-222-1222) for public use regarding questions, concerns, and other information related to coronavirus spread in New Jersey.
